个人简介

刘奇航,南方科技大学物理系副教授,研究员,主要从事以密度泛函理论为主的凝聚态理论研究,聚焦真实材料。研究兴趣包括理解材料中新奇的电学,磁学,光学,缺陷,自旋极化,拓扑等性质及它们的耦合,以及功能导向的新型材料设计及预测。刘奇航博士以第一作者或通讯作者身份已发表包括Nat. Phys., Phys. Rev. X, Phys, Rev. Lett., Nano Lett., Adv. Funct. Mater. 等多篇学术论文;署名作者共计已发表学术论文30余篇,Google Scholar统计引用超过2300次;担任Phys. Rev. Lett., Nano Lett., Adv. Mater. 等期刊审稿人。
